3. Setup and Installation
3.1 System Requirements
- PCI-Express x16 slot on motherboard
- Minimum 750W power supply unit (PSU) recommended, with appropriate 8-pin PCIe power connectors.
- Compatible operating system (e.g., Windows 10/11 64-bit)
- Sufficient case clearance for card dimensions (approximately 26.7 cm L x 13.5 cm W, occupying 2.5 PCIe slots).
3.2 Physical Installation
- Power Off: Turn off your computer and disconnect the power cable from the wall outlet.
- Open Case: Remove the side panel of your computer case.
- Locate PCIe Slot: Identify an available PCI-Express x16 slot on your motherboard. Remove any expansion slot covers that may obstruct the installation.
- Insert Graphics Card: Carefully align the graphics card with the PCIe slot and press it down firmly until it is securely seated. The retention clip on the motherboard should click into place.
- Secure Card: Fasten the graphics card to the case using the screw or latch mechanism provided by your case.
- Connect Power: Connect the required 8-pin PCIe power cables from your power supply to the corresponding connectors on the graphics card. Ensure all connections are firm.
- Install Support Bracket: If included, install the graphics card support bracket to prevent sag and provide additional stability. Follow the instructions provided with the bracket.
- Close Case: Replace the computer case side panel.
- Reconnect Power: Reconnect the power cable to the wall outlet.

5. Maintenance
5.1 Cleaning
Regular cleaning helps maintain optimal performance and extends the lifespan of your graphics card. Dust accumulation can impede cooling efficiency.
- Frequency: Clean your graphics card every 3-6 months, or more frequently in dusty environments.
- Procedure:
- Power off your computer and disconnect the power cable.
- Carefully remove the graphics card from your system (optional, but recommended for thorough cleaning).
- Use compressed air to gently blow dust out of the heatsink fins and fan blades. Hold the fans to prevent them from spinning rapidly during cleaning.
- Wipe the exterior of the card with a soft, dry, anti-static cloth.
- Reinstall the graphics card and reconnect all cables.

6. Troubleshooting
If you encounter issues with your graphics card, refer to the following common troubleshooting steps:
- No Display Output:
- Ensure the monitor is powered on and connected to the graphics card, not the motherboard's integrated graphics.
- Verify that the graphics card is fully seated in the PCIe slot and all power cables are securely connected.
- Test with a different display cable or monitor if possible.
- Driver Issues / Instability:
- Perform a clean reinstallation of the graphics drivers. Use a driver uninstaller utility (e.g., DDU - Display Driver Uninstaller) in Safe Mode to remove old drivers before installing new ones.
- Ensure your operating system is up to date.
- Poor Performance / Overheating:
- Check GPU temperatures using AMD Software: Adrenalin Edition. Ensure adequate airflow within your PC case.
- Verify that your power supply unit meets the recommended wattage (750W minimum).
- Clean dust from the graphics card heatsink and fans.
- Ensure your CPU and RAM are not bottlenecking the GPU.
- Physical Fit Issues:
- If the card does not fit, check your case dimensions against the card's dimensions (26.7 cm L x 13.5 cm W) and ensure sufficient clearance for its 2.5-slot width.

7. Technical Specifications
| Feature | Specification |
|---|---|
| Model Name | Sapphire Pure AMD Radeon RX 7800 XT Gaming OC |
| Model Number | 11330-03-20G |
| Graphics Processor | AMD Radeon RX 7800 XT |
| GPU Series | AMD Radeon RX 7000 Series |
| Game Clock | Up to 2169 MHz |
| Graphics RAM | 16 GB GDDR6 |
| Memory Interface | 256-bit |
| Effective Memory Speed | 19.5 Gb/s |
| Video Output Interface | DisplayPort, HDMI (Dual HDMI/Dual DP) |
| Graphics Card Interface | PCI-Express x16 |
| Maximum Screen Resolution | 7680 x 4320 |
| Number of Fans | 3 |
| Item Dimensions (L x W) | 26.7 cm x 13.5 cm |
| Item Weight | 1400 Grams |
| Recommended Uses | Videogames |
| Compatible Devices | Desktop Computer |
| Manufacturer | Sapphire Technology |
| Country of Origin | Germany |
